你知道什么是容灾吗
你有没有猎奇过,假设出现地震或其别人造灾祸,你在某家银行的账户消息能否会失落?你存在银行的钱还在吗?
其实,这并不用咱们操心。银行的用户消息是十分关键的数据,因此银行开设之前必需领有一套完整的容灾处置打算来处置这类疑问,即建设容灾系统。
所谓容灾系统,字面了解就是指容忍劫难的系统。有了这个系统,哪怕是劫难来袭,银行里的用户数据也可以坦然自若。这个劫难,大到人造灾祸,小到物理缺点。为了保证数据的安保性和业务的牢靠性,每家银行会在国际多个地域建设一个或几个容灾站点,相互之间备份数据,相当于发明几个“正本”。
当主用站点遭逢劫难破坏,造成数据出现终身性失落时,就可仰仗容灾站点的“正本”,成功数据复原。假设没有容灾站点的数据备份,将会形成无法估计的经济损失和顽劣的社会影响。
银行有容灾系统,通讯有没有容灾系统呢?答案是必需的。每个运营商都制订了一套完整严密的容灾处置打算,来保证一切用户的通讯数据,包含你的话费余额!
无论是3G、4G还是5G,每个运营商都为本地域的通讯业务建设了容灾局点。容灾局点除了能保证各类数据的牢靠,更能够保证业务的可用性。这才是建设容灾系统最关键的意义。
以5GC为例,与金融系统相似,5GC也驳回跨地域的他乡容灾部署形式。在两个不同的地域区分部署数据中心(DC,DataCenter),当某地DC中的网络设施由于某种要素无法用时,由另一地DC迅速接收业务,从而保证5G业务的可用性。这就是双DC部署。双DC部署是成功部署牢靠性的一种形式。
除了双DC部署,5GC容灾处置打算还提供哪些措施成功容灾呢?
部署牢靠性
5GC容灾处置打算允许双DC部署、互斥部署、NF(Network Function 网络性能)分域部署、网络双平面等形式成功部署牢靠性。
互斥部署是指将虚机部署在不同的物理机上,从而保证当某个物理机出现意外时,其他虚机仍能够提供服务。简而言之就是“鸡蛋不要放在一个篮子里”。
NF分域部署是指NF部署驳回治理域、业务域、转发域分别的形式启动。
网络双平面是指5GCNF一切逻辑网络接口,都至少有2个不同的物理网络平面互为备份。当其中一个网络平面出现缺点时,另一个网络平面能够接收一切的网络流量,保证业务不终止。
架构牢靠性
5GC容灾处置打算允许负荷分担和有形态个性等形式,从而成功架构牢靠性。
负荷分担是指,一切运转实例独特分担处置业务。当局部运转实例意外宕机时,由其他运转反常的实例独特分担处置业务,从而保证业务反常运转。负荷分担驳回N+M冗余形式,即当N个实例可以满足系统容量的业务处置时,再提供M个实例用于冗余。
上图是典型的3+1冗余形式,当3个实例可以满足系统容量的业务处置时,再提供1个实例用于冗余。当任何1个运转实例缺点时,其他3个运转实例继续上班,从而保证系统容量及业务处置不受影响。
有形态是指微服务的有形态设计。3GPP 定义了UDSF(Unstructured>
数据牢靠性
5GC的NF按有形态设计,在处置流程成功后,将用户及会话高低文等形态数据保留在UDSF中,由UDSF对数据启动多正本保留。UDSF允许1+1冗余、双DC部署的容灾形式,从而保证数据牢靠性。
资源牢靠性
5GC容灾处置打算允许链路检测、自愈等机制成功资源牢靠性。
自愈是指:关于继续出现缺点的业务处置节点,系统会启动节点的多级自愈。依据用户的自愈战略性能,系统依次驳回重启容器、重推容器、重启虚机、重建虚机逐级回升的战略启动自愈,从而尽快复原业务。
链路检测是指:业务节点会定时发送心跳保活报文给治理节点,治理节点检测出长期间未发心跳的节点,则判定为缺点节点,从而触发业务迁徙流程,把缺点节点的业务迁徙到其他反常节点,从而保证业务的牢靠性。
好了,话说到这里,你再也不用担忧你的话费余额了吧,更不用担忧存在银行的money了吧!你也知道什么是容灾了吧。